Reliance ADAG Enters Online Retail With RelianceMoneyMall.com

Reliance Money which is part of the Reliance ADA Group, has launched a new e-commerce Web portal  for a range of financial as well as non financial products. Called reliancemoneymall.com, the ecommerce portal will sell insurance, mutual funds and bullion and non-financial products such as apparel, accessories, books/ magazines, music CDs and DVDs, home appliances, gifts, flowers etc.

reliance money mall

The portal is setup in partnership with Microsoft which seems to be using the portal to promote the download of silverlight software. Infact a rich media version of the site entirely built in silverlight is also available. It seems that Microsoft built this portal free of cost for Reliance for some branding.

Reliance money has stated that it expects to generate 10-15 per cent of its total revenues from online advertising, said Mr Sudip Bandyopadhyay the CEO of Reliance Money.

Just recently Reliance Money had tied up with Apnaloan for content. It seems Reliance money is pretty upbeat on the digital medium though given the times that we are it seems like an unlikely time that anyone will buy financial products let alone online.
